David Beckham Sends Heartfelt Message to Paul Scholes’ Daughter After Emotional Interview
Former football star David Beckham recently reached out to Paul Scholes’ daughter, Alicia, in response to a touching tribute she posted after her father revealed his decision to step away from commentary work. Scholes made this choice to accommodate his schedule around his autistic son, Aiden, a decision that resonated deeply with many.
An Emotional Revelation
Paul Scholes, a former England midfielder and Manchester United legend, shared his personal struggles and sacrifices in an emotional interview with his ex-teammates Gary Neville and Roy Keane. He explained how he had to prioritize his family, especially his son Aiden, who has autism, over his professional commitments, leading to his decision to stop doing commentary work.
Scholes’ candid discussion shed light on the challenges faced by families dealing with autism and the difficult choices parents often have to make to provide the best care for their children. His decision to prioritize his son’s needs touched the hearts of many, including his former teammates and fans.
A Heartfelt Message
David Beckham, who played alongside Scholes at Manchester United and for the English national team, was moved by Alicia Scholes’ tribute to her father’s selfless decision. In response, Beckham reached out to Alicia with a heartfelt message of support and admiration for the Scholes family.
